Which would be the most important action immediately following extubation of a patient?
Encourage patient to deep breathe and use incentive spirometer
Offer the patient medication for sedation
Assess patient's ability to speak
Assess vital signs and effort of breathing
The Correct Answer is D
Choice A reason:
Encouraging the patient to deep breathe and use an incentive spirometer is important for lung expansion and preventing atelectasis. However, it is not the most immediate action following extubation.
Choice B reason:
Offering the patient medication for sedation is not appropriate immediately following extubation, as it could depress respiratory function and interfere with the patient's ability to clear secretions and maintain an open airway.
Choice C reason:
Assessing the patient's ability to speak is important to ensure that the vocal cords were not damaged during the intubation process. However, this is secondary to ensuring that the patient is breathing effectively and maintaining adequate oxygenation.
Choice D reason:
Assessing vital signs and effort of breathing is the most immediate and important action following extubation. Monitoring the patient’s respiratory status ensures that they are maintaining a patent airway, breathing effectively, and not experiencing respiratory distress or failure.
